GENERAL SUMMARY
The role of the Specification Engineer is to provide engineering expertise to the Aftermarket (AM) Business with a focus on BOM Creation, supporting Sales, Tendering, Operations, Sales, and Field Service activities globally. To work as a member of the AM Specification Team to produce manufacturing BOM’s and purchase specifications for pump assembly manufacture, pump parts manufacture and service center overhauls etc.
